[发明专利]一种基于SLAM的定位方法和系统有效
| 申请号: | 201711173777.8 | 申请日: | 2017-11-22 |
| 公开(公告)号: | CN107990899B | 公开(公告)日: | 2020-06-30 |
| 发明(设计)人: | 蔡少骏;孟超 | 申请(专利权)人: | 驭势科技(北京)有限公司 |
| 主分类号: | G01C21/20 | 分类号: | G01C21/20;G06T7/70 |
| 代理公司: | 北京睿邦知识产权代理事务所(普通合伙) 11481 | 代理人: | 徐丁峰 |
| 地址: | 102400 北京市*** | 国省代码: | 北京;11 |
| 权利要求书: | 查看更多 | 说明书: | 查看更多 |
| 摘要: | |||
| 搜索关键词: | 一种 基于 slam 定位 方法 系统 | ||
本发明公开了一种基于SLAM的定位方法和系统。本发明的方法包括步骤:计算相机在全局地图中的初始位置,其中所述的全局地图是指双目SLAM全局地图;从全局地图中根据相机的初始位置提取局部地图;匹配当前帧和局部地图点;基于当前帧和局部地图点的匹配结果触发单目SLAM定位,其中,所述的单目SLAM定位通过单目相机生成新的地图点用于定位。本发明能够在定位质量差时,触发单目SLAM定位来补充地图点,增加定位的准确度并提高定位的效率,而在定位质量好和定位丢失的情况下则进行基本的地图定位。
技术领域
本申请涉及人工智能领域,尤其涉及无人驾驶的定位方法和装置。
背景技术
视觉SLAM是21世纪SLAM研究热点之一,一方面是因为视觉十分直观,另一方面,由于CPU、GPU处理速度的增长,使得许多以前被认为无法实时化的视觉算法,得以在10Hz以上的速度运行。硬件的提高也促进了视觉SLAM的发展。
以传感器而论,视觉SLAM研究主要分为三大类:单目、双目(或多目)、RGBD。其余还有鱼眼、全景等特殊相机,但是在研究和产品中都属于少数。此外,结合惯性测量器件(Inertial Measurement Unit,IMU)的视觉SLAM也是现在研究热点之一。就实现难度而言,我们可以大致将这三类方法排序为:单目视觉双目视觉RGBD。
在智能家居或智能穿戴场景中,定位的应用是非常广泛的,然而通常情况下通过GPS定位、AGPS定位基、站定位和WiFi定位等方式来定位,对信号要求较高,容易被干扰,并且定位精度较低误差大。
现有技术中,双目SLAM定位对定位数据的质量的要求较高,对低质量的定位数据无法处理,而仅仅靠反复进行双目定位并过滤低质量的定位数据来解决定位准确度问题。这样,使得双目定位的应用范围收到局限,难以提高定位效率和精度。
在无人驾驶领域,利用双目SLAM定位还存在改进的必要。
发明内容
为了解决上述技术问题,提出了本申请。本申请的实施例提供了一种基于SLAM的定位方法、装置、电子设备和计算机可读存储介质,以增加自动驾驶的定位准确度并提高定位效率。
根据本申请的一个方面,提供一种基于SLAM的定位方法,包括如下步骤:计算相机在全局地图中的初始位置,其中所述的全局地图是指双目SLAM全局地图;从全局地图中根据相机的初始位置提取局部地图;匹配当前帧和局部地图点;基于当前帧和局部地图点的匹配结果触发单目SLAM定位;其中,所述的单目SLAM定位通过单目相机生成新的地图点用于定位。
作为优选方式,所述的基于当前帧和局部地图点的匹配结果触发单目SLAM定位包括:当前帧与局部地图点的匹配个数小于第一阈值且大于第二阈值时,定位质量差,触发单目SLAM定位;当前帧与局部地图点的匹配个数小于第二阈值时,定位丢失,重新计算相机初始位置;当前帧与局部地图点的匹配个数大于第一阈值时,持续获取定位信息;其中,所述第一阈值大于所述第二阈值。
作为优选方式,所述单目SLAM定位包括:获取单目图像,并与当前地图进行匹配,所述匹配是指对于当前单目图像的每个特征描述子,从当前地图中找到与描述子最接近的地图点;判断单目图像是否匹配成功;若匹配成功,以前一帧或后一帧的位姿作为初值,求解位姿;若匹配不成功,退出单目SLAM定位。
作为优选方式,所述的匹配成功、持续获取定位信息进一步包括:对已知位姿信息的多帧图像进行三角化;根据三角化的结果,生成临时地图点,并加入当前地图。
作为优选方式,所述的当前地图是指以局部地图为初始地图、不断加入临时地图点的地图。
作为优选方式,所述方法进一步包括退出单目SLAM定位后,清除临时地图点。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于驭势科技(北京)有限公司,未经驭势科技(北京)有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201711173777.8/2.html,转载请声明来源钻瓜专利网。
- 上一篇:行驶路径生成装置
- 下一篇:一种行人室内定位数据的粒子滤波器模型设计方法





